WebSep 5, 2024 · What are Fischer projections used for? Fischer projections are a convenient way to depict chiral molecules (see optical activity) and distinguish between pairs of enantiomers (see racemic mixture). WebThe Fischer projection of D-glyceraldehyde is given below. Draw D-glyceraldehyde using wedge and dash bonds around the chirality center and including ALL hydrogen atoms. Ribose is an aldose monosaccharide. The Fischer projection of L-ribose is given below. Draw L-ribose using wedge and dash bonds around the chiral carbon atom (s).
